Software Engineer
Wellframe
Software Engineering
Bengaluru, Karnataka, India
Software Engineer
- ID
- 2026-7677
- Position Type
- Full-Time
Overview
Software Engineer (Care Solution Bengaluru):
Position Overview:
We are seeking a talented Software Engineer to join our Bengaluru-based team, focusing on developing and maintaining code for GuidingCare while supporting integration features with Wellframe. This role offers an excellent opportunity for engineers with 2-4 years of experience to work on innovative healthcare solutions while collaborating with cross-functional teams. You'll contribute to building a cutting-edge Digital Health Management platform that meaningfully impacts patient care and health outcomes.
RESPONSIBILITIES
- Development & Implementation: Design, develop, and maintain software solutions for Care-Wellframe integration using modern technologies and frameworks. Leverage AI tools (ChatGPT, Claude, GitHub Copilot) and agentic AI workflows to accelerate development and improve code quality.
- Code Quality: Write clean, optimized, and well-documented code following industry best practices and coding standards.
- Feature Development: Build application features, user interfaces, and databases that support seamless integration between GuidingCare and Wellframe.
- Testing & Debugging: Develop and execute unit test cases, debug existing code, and ensure products function correctly in controlled environments before deployment.
- Data Management: Work with large volumes of data, ensuring proper modeling, analysis, and management.
- Collaboration: Partner with multidisciplinary teams including product managers, designers, and senior engineers to translate requirements into technical solutions.
- Learning & Growth: Actively seek opportunities to learn new technologies and methodologies while contributing to innovative solutions.
- Problem Solving: Troubleshoot and resolve technical challenges within software systems, ensuring robustness and customer satisfaction.
- On-call Support: Participate in on-call rotations to support the systems owned by your team.
BASIC QUALIFICATIONS
- Education: Bachelor's degree in Computer Science, Information Technology, Engineering, or a related field.
- Experience: 2-4 years of hands-on software development experience.
SKILLS & COMPETENCIES
Technical Skills:
- Experience with Microsoft platform (ASP.NET, MVC, C#) is advantageous
- Hands-on experience with React or other modern front-end frameworks (, Vue.js)
- Knowledge of RESTful APIs, Web Services, JSON, and XML
- Experience with SQL databases (MySQL, PostgreSQL, SQL Server) and writing SQL queries
- Understanding of MVC architecture and software design principles
- Familiarity with version control systems (GIT)
- Basic understanding of cloud platforms (AWS, Azure, GCP)
- Experience using AI coding assistants (GitHub Copilot, Cursor, etc.) and agentic AI tools (ChatGPT, Claude) for development tasks
Soft Skills:
- Strong analytical and problem-solving abilities
- Good communication and collaboration skills
- Ability to work independently and as part of a team
- Adaptability to fast-paced, dynamic environments
- Eagerness to learn and continuously improve
- Customer-centric mindset with attention to detail
- Demonstrated ability to effectively leverage AI tools as productivity multipliers
PREFERRED QUALIFICATIONS
- Understanding of Ruby on Rails
- Understanding of
- Knowledge of message queues (Kafka, RabbitMQ)
- Exposure to microservices architecture
- Understanding of DevOps practices and CI/CD pipelines
- Active involvement in open-source projects or tech communities
- Experience in healthcare technology or digital health solutions
[NW1]Consider increased emphasis of AI in responsibilities and skills sections.
[NW2]Vue?
I have modified the requirement accordingly
[NW4]Why Java required and .NET preferred?
I have moved it to preferred qualification
[NW6]Already mentioned above
Done
[NW8]Separate these two?
Done
Options
Software Powered by iCIMS
www.icims.com